Recycling Today is updating its list of North America's largest ferrous scrap processors, which was last published in May 2014.
The key figure we are asking for is the annual amount of ferrous scrap physically handled at your company’s facilities in 2015. This would include scrap taken in at all facilities, whether it is processed further or shipped loose. For exporters, this would include all ferrous scrap purchased for export and loaded onto a vessel. This would not include scrap brokered by traders or brokers employed by the company that is never physically present at a corporate facility.
